FORT LAUDERDALE, Fla. -- Broward authorities are investigating reports that someone in a pickup truck threw a cat and three kittens out of a window onto a ramp of Interstate 95. The older cat survived, but the three kittens were found dead.

The cat -- gray and white like the kittens -- was discovered in a storm drain near the ramp from Oakland Park Boulevard onto southbound I-95, near where the kittens were tossed around 9:30 a.m. Monday.

Beth Danielson of Pompano Beach, who heads the volunteer group Feline-n-Feathers, said she received a call from a friend who said someone saw a man throwing the animals out of a white Chevrolet pickup truck.

Danielson called 911 and then said she headed toward the ramp, where she said she found the kittens dead on the pavement and the mother cat hiding in the drain.

Danielson is caring for the gray cat, which will most likely be put up for adoption. Danielson said the cat's claws had been broken off, probably from the impact after being thrown from the truck and landing on the pavement.
